When the fluid flows through a pipe that has varying diameter and height, the pressure and energy densities at two locations along the pipe are related as: For a fluid flowing at a constant depth/height, the above equation changes to: In other words, as the speed of a moving fluid increases, its pressure drops and vice-versa. WebGPM (Gallons per Minute) Calculator To find the output flow of a hydraulic pump, use this pump flow formula: Flow (GPM) = (RPM x Disp) / 231. The physiological and medical norm for respiratory minute ventilation at rest is 6 liters per minute for a 70 kg man (see references for textbooks below: Guyton, 1984; Ganong, 1995; Straub, 1998; Castro, 2000; etc.). Using Bernoulli's equation for fluid flow at constant depth, we can write: Hence, to determine the velocity, we should take the pressure difference between the two points, multiply it by 2, divide the result by the density of water and then take its square root.
